Topology optimization is a software-based method that helps in reducing extra material that isn’t necessary to the overall function of a product, by analysing stress distribution and the amount of strain energy.
By building lightweight yet strong products, engineers can guarantee that their designs are not just durable, but also can be produced while keeping costs under control and on-time.
To effectively implement the topology optimization technique during the concept design stage, design engineers must have a certain level of specialized knowledge and expertise
